The thing you have to remember when talking about quiet helmets is that every bike directs the airflow across the helmet differently! if you had your helmet and a Goldwing (presuming you don't ;) ) you may say your helmet is the quietest one you've ever worn! your helmet on a naked may even be quiet but with it on a sports bike the fairing may direct the wind straight at your head with the results you have now! so when someone says "X" type helmet is really quiet you also have tolook at what they're riding!

I found my old CMS helmet that weighs an absolute shitload and doesn't breathe at all is quiter than my Shoei and the Shoei is "fairly" quiet with vents closed, open em up though and it's loud, so what I can assume from that is, if you want a helmet that's quiet, then prepare to suffocate, want one that breathes, prepare for te noise factor :D

I also have a top of the range Arai (from 2002) and it is louder than I want (and I always wear good quality ear plugs).
I seem to remember than my previous Shoei was quieter (but that may just be old age).
Most people now ride with ear plugs so the question may be what are the quietest ear plugs you can get.
I use ones rated 26.7db, that is supposed to be the amount by which they reduce noise, about $4 for 2 pairs in discount chemist.
